Head to head

Enclomiphene against HCG

Two ways to raise testosterone without replacing it, one oral and acting at the pituitary, one injected and acting at the testis. HCG is approved; enclomiphene is not, and is supplied through compounding.

Column A

Enclomiphene

Enclomiphene citrate

The trans isomer of clomiphene, prescribed off-label through compounding to raise testosterone while preserving sperm production; never FDA-approved on its own after repeated complete response letters.

Column B

HCG

Human Chorionic Gonadotropin

An FDA-approved gonadotropin used in fertility and to maintain testicular function and testosterone production in men.

Side by side, on the facts we can check

AttributeEnclomipheneHCG
CategoryHormoneHormone
FDA statusNot FDA-approved (complete response letters); available as a compounded prescriptionFDA-approved for fertility and hypogonadism (not for weight loss)
Half-lifeOnce-daily oral dosing~24-36 hours
Molecular weight406.0 Da~36,700 Da
MechanismSelective estrogen receptor antagonism at the hypothalamus, increasing GnRH, LH and FSH and therefore endogenous testosterone.Activates LH receptors to stimulate testicular testosterone production and, in women, support ovulation and the corpus luteum.
Human studies cited12
Legal status, USPrescription via compounding pharmacies; not FDA-approvedFDA-approved, prescription only

Which has stronger research evidence, Enclomiphene or HCG?

This database does not grade compounds. It counts what was run in people: 1 of the 2 studies cited on the Enclomiphene profile were human work, against 2 of 4 for HCG. Those counts are of our own citation lists and understate any larger literature, and neither is a recommendation.

Are Enclomiphene and HCG FDA-approved?

Enclomiphene: Not FDA-approved (complete response letters); available as a compounded prescription. HCG: FDA-approved for fertility and hypogonadism (not for weight loss).
